Why does running firebase emulators also execute one of my functions?

I run firebase emulators:start --only functions,firestore and get the following output:

$ firebase emulators:start  --only functions,firestore
i  emulators: Starting emulators: functions, firestore

>  TEST TEST 123

The function is defined in functions/scraper/index.js as:

exports.scraper = url => {
  console.log('TEST TEST', url)
  return null
}

It is imported and called as such in functions/cron/index.js

const functions = require('firebase-functions')
const test = require('../scraper')

const schedule = `every 6 hours`
exports.testFunction = functions.pubsub
  .schedule(schedule)
  .onRun(test.scraper('123'))

How come I see TEST TEST 123 output from this function but not my other functions? How can I avoid this function being executed when running emulators?

I am trying to test a scheduled cron function locally but it keeps being executed when emulators are run.

By writing .onRun(test.scraper('123')) you are asking pubsub to run the returned value of test.scraper('123') . That's why the function is called during environment initialization.

If you want to run test.scraper('123') every 6 hours, you have to wrap it into a function.

exports.testFunction = functions.pubsub
  .schedule(schedule)
  .onRun(() => test.scraper('123'))

To be more clear:

exports.testFunction = functions.pubsub
  .schedule(schedule)
  .onRun(scheduledFunction)

function scheduledFunction() {
  test.scraper('123')
}
